We have now completed our plans and risk assessments, adhering to the updated guidance from the Department for Education and taking advice from the childcare sector of the local authority.


We are delighted to inform parents and carers that the pre-school at Upwood Small to Tall will be opening from Monday 7th September between the hours of 9am and 3.30pm. Further information will follow around the safe return of pre-school children.


Unfortunately, we are unable to re-open the extended provision of breakfast and after school clubs at this time. We are so sorry; we know that many of you need childcare before and after school, but the guidance has not yet relaxed enough for a setting like ours to re-open safely.


This decision has been made for the following reasons:


- We have two classrooms. Rooms cannot be used by different groups unless the room and resources are cleaned thoroughly between group changes. With staggered start/finish times in school, this would mean pre-school starting at 10.30am and ending at 2.00pm to allow for cleaning between use.


- We looked at having one room solely for pre-school and one for after school club, but we are only allowed 15 children in a group and these should ideally be consistent with the school bubbles.


- The guidance tells us that if school year group bubbles cannot be maintained into the clubs, then groups should be consistent throughout the week. Children’s attendance patterns at Upwood Small to Tall are all different with varying groups each day of the week. This would undermine both the guidance and the measures put in place by school to minimise the amount of

‘mixing’ to reduce the risk of infection.


We are very sorry that we have to delay this service, we know how important it is to our families, but the safety of children and adults at Upwood Small to Tall has to be given utmost priority. The local authority has advised us to review the situation in the October half term.
